—Henry doesn’t seem like the same person.
— so much in the war has made him more thoughtful.
A. For him to see
B. His seeing
C. Having seen
D. To be seeing
网友回答
A. For him to see
(答案→)B. His seeing
C. Having seen
D. To be seeing
解析:很明显答语在结构上缺少主语。To do 与-ing都可充当主语,但 to do充当主语多表示某一具体的动作,且多表将来。故选B。